Understanding Vehicle Diagnostics
In today's automotive landscape, an extensive understanding of auto diagnostics is crucial for efficient car fixing and maintenance. Car diagnostics encompasses a series of methods and devices used to recognize and analyze automobile efficiency problems. This process commonly involves making use of specific tools to recover information from the lorry's onboard computer system systems, which monitor numerous parts including the engine, transmission, and discharges systems.
Modern cars are equipped with sophisticated diagnostic capabilities that can disclose mistake codes, sensor analyses, and system standings. Service technicians use these diagnostics to determine concerns that might not be promptly noticeable with traditional examination techniques. An accurate diagnosis develops the structure for any repair process, permitting targeted treatments instead of guesswork, which can result in unnecessary repair work and boosted expenses.
Comprehending the principles of auto diagnostics also includes experience with the numerous analysis devices readily available, including OBD-II scanners, multimeters, and oscilloscopes. Mastery of these tools makes it possible for technicians to analyze information properly and apply their findings to recover automobile capability. As auto modern technology remains to develop, staying informed concerning the current diagnostic methodologies and tools is vital for vehicle specialists seeking to offer top notch solution.

Usual Concerns Determined
Frequently come across issues in vehicle fixing diagnostics consist of problems with the ignition system, fuel distribution, and electrical parts. Ignition system failures commonly manifest as engine misfires or failing to start, frequently as a result of defective ignition system, ignition coils, or timing issues. These issues can severely influence engine performance and fuel performance.
Gas shipment problems, such as clogged up fuel filters or falling short gas pumps, can bring about inadequate fuel getting to the engine, causing poor acceleration and delaying. Diagnostics in these cases focus on fuel stress examinations and examining fuel injectors to make sure correct functioning.
Electrical elements are one more regular resource of analysis challenges. Faulty circuitry, blown merges, or malfunctioning sensing units can prevent lorry operations, resulting in dashboard warning lights or erratic performance. Service technicians often utilize multimeters and diagnostic scanners to determine electrical mistakes accurately.
